A Zorua and a Fennekin, living in the wild keeping away from the humans and hanging with their friends and maybe fighting some baddies along the way? You can take your pokeballs and Shuppet, Cain and Mabel don't need a trainer when they have each other. - Description on Webtoons.

Cain and Mabel is a Pokémon fan made Webcomic from Scape Goat Comics, created by Rhys Horton, and as the above descriptions states, it follows a Zorua and a Fennekin couple along with their friends living in a Pokémon reserve area of Santalune Forest where no human is allowed to catch them and all the shenanigans they get into.

The series can be read on DeviantArt, Webtoon and Tapas.

The current comic is a Lighter and Softer reboot of an an older one of the same name focusing on the two titular characters that can be found on the creator's DeviantArt page linked above.

The current comic has received a reading by OVAS of Mew and Mewtwo fame.
